What is KindNest, and who do you serve?

KindNest is a nonprofit organization dedicated to supporting mothers, pregnant women, and infants by providing essential items such as diapers, wipes, formula, clothing, and hygiene products. We serve families in need throughout Genesee County and surrounding areas, offering both care packages and community resources.

How can I request support from KindNest?

To request support, simply fill out our online application form. You’ll be able to specify the items your family needs, and we’ll do our best to match your request with available donations. All applications are confidential, and we do not require proof of income to receive help.

Is my donation tax-deductible?

Yes! KindNest is a registered 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ization. All monetary and in-kind donations are tax-deductible to the extent permitted by law. We’re happy to provide a donation receipt upon request.
